Intended Use
The ECG Cable is intended to be used with ECG. The ECG Cable is used to connect electrodes placed at appropriate sites on the patient to ECG for general monitoring and/or diagnostic evaluation by health care professional.
Device Description
The ECG Cable is an external device used to transmit ECG signals from electrodes that are affixed to the patient's body for both diagnostic and monitoring purposes. One end of each leadwire is attached to ECG patient electrodes; the other end is affixed / molded into one end of the trunk cable which are plug into an ECG monitor.

Summary of Performance Studies

The following performance data were provided in support of the substantial equivalence determination.

Biocompatibility testing: The biocompatibility evaluation for the Changke ECG Cables was conducted in accordance with the FDA Guidance for Industry and Food and Drug Administration Staff: Use of International Standard ISO 10993-1, "Biological evaluation of medical devices - Part 1: Evaluation and testing within a risk management process". The battery of testing included the following tests: Cytotoxicity, Sensitization, and Irritation. The subject devices are considered surface contacting for a duration of exceed 24 hours but not 30 days.

Non-clinical data: The Changke ECG Cables have been tested according to the following standards:

  • IEC 60601-1: 2005+CORR.1: 2006+CORR.2: 2007+A1: 2012, Medical Electrical Equipment-Part 1: General requirements for basic safety and essential performance
  • ANSI/AAMI EC53: 2013 ECG Trunk Cables and Patient Leadwires.
    The test was selected to show substantial equivalence between the subject device and the predicate.

Clinical data: No clinical study is included in this submission.

§ 870.2900 Patient transducer and electrode cable (including connector).

(a)
Identification. A patient transducer and electrode cable (including connector) is an electrical conductor used to transmit signals from, or power or excitation signals to, patient-connected electrodes or transducers.(b)
Classification. Class II (performance standards).
